Position sensors are devices used to detect and measure the displacement, angular rotation, or linear movement of objects or components in mechanical systems. They provide feedback on the position, velocity, and direction of motion, enabling precise control and monitoring of machine movements, robotic systems, and industrial processes. Position sensors come in various types including angle sensors and linear position sensors, each tailored to specific measurement requirements and environmental conditions. Angle sensors measure angular displacement or rotation, while linear position sensors measure linear displacement along a specified axis. These sensors utilize different sensing principles such as resistive, inductive, capacitive, magnetic, or optical sensing techniques to detect and quantify position changes accurately. Position sensors find applications in automotive systems, aerospace, robotics, industrial automation, and consumer electronics where precise position feedback is critical for system operation, control, and safety.
